nymkappa
|
1074d23a90
|
Cleanup some ops logs
|
2022-06-13 10:12:27 +02:00 |
|
hunicus
|
8154a4dd77
|
Clarify that manual installs are meant for devs
|
2022-06-11 11:05:53 -04:00 |
|
wiz
|
2492bc69ff
|
Merge pull request #1860 from hunicus/npm-install-note
Update npm install command and node.js requirements
|
2022-06-11 05:23:08 +09:00 |
|
wiz
|
b9f0e63341
|
Bump version numbers to v2.4.1-dev
|
2022-06-10 22:43:57 +09:00 |
|
hunicus
|
ca41edea22
|
Update npm install command
|
2022-06-09 18:15:20 -04:00 |
|
wiz
|
f901f06992
|
Release v2.4.0
|
2022-06-09 23:10:18 +09:00 |
|
nymkappa
|
be8ee52af0
|
Fix pool import crash
|
2022-06-07 22:18:51 +02:00 |
|
wiz
|
0b50c17ed0
|
Merge branch 'master' into nymkappa/bugfix/db-disabled
|
2022-06-08 01:56:52 +09:00 |
|
nymkappa
|
53bc80e899
|
Add 'db-less' mining pool tagging support
|
2022-06-07 11:28:39 +02:00 |
|
Ayanami
|
56dc337672
|
Temporary disable retries
Until we find out how to sync async
|
2022-06-07 04:16:37 +09:00 |
|
Ayanami
|
a04bafdb4c
|
Correct the log if the onion address is enabled or not
|
2022-06-07 04:16:37 +09:00 |
|
Ayanami
|
6ff473ab5d
|
Add an ability to change circuits
|
2022-06-07 04:16:37 +09:00 |
|
Ayanami
|
40bfc6bff3
|
Include SocksProxyAgent inside while loop
To address error Socks5 proxy rejected connection - Failure
|
2022-06-07 04:16:37 +09:00 |
|
Ayanami
|
c610cacee4
|
Added missing config value
addressing comments from @knorrium
|
2022-06-07 04:16:36 +09:00 |
|
Ayanami
|
e41a08789a
|
Added configurable user-agent for axios
Will use `mempool/v${backendInfo.getBackendInfo().version}` for default
|
2022-06-07 04:16:36 +09:00 |
|
Ayanami
|
9d5bbf1f44
|
Handle Error with basic retry while syncing external assets ( Price Data )
+ Removed unused External Assets value
+ Make static URL dynamic
+ Added config options for syncing pool data
+ Added retry interval & max retry
|
2022-06-07 04:16:36 +09:00 |
|
softsimon
|
ebda00dc74
|
Send empty list of transactions if data isn't available yet
|
2022-06-06 14:31:17 +04:00 |
|
nymkappa
|
b60c2a9341
|
Improve disk cache logging
|
2022-06-03 18:00:14 +02:00 |
|
nymkappa
|
3bc55d80ce
|
Re-added missing cache version
|
2022-06-03 17:04:52 +02:00 |
|
nymkappa
|
256dbc8c8e
|
Add disk cache versioning
|
2022-06-03 13:31:45 +02:00 |
|
wiz
|
11f5056871
|
Merge pull request #1784 from hunicus/node-version-requirement
Make node 16.15 required not recommended
|
2022-06-03 02:53:55 +09:00 |
|
hunicus
|
83660e9cf3
|
Make node 16.15 required not recommended
|
2022-06-01 22:54:46 -04:00 |
|
softsimon
|
f0a2ddf57b
|
Minor refactor for projected block transactions
|
2022-06-02 01:29:03 +04:00 |
|
Mononaut
|
3ffc4956f4
|
Stream projected block deltas instead of full data
|
2022-06-01 13:48:58 +00:00 |
|
Mononaut
|
79dae84363
|
Data pipeline for projected mempool block overview
|
2022-06-01 13:48:34 +00:00 |
|
wiz
|
ee5cd1cd96
|
Merge pull request #1769 from mempool/nymkappa/bugfix/divergence-fix
Re-add hash field in the mysql block query
|
2022-06-01 17:20:38 +09:00 |
|
nymkappa
|
d860344be4
|
Re-add hash field in the mysql block query
|
2022-06-01 10:06:18 +02:00 |
|
softsimon
|
2ee1f197d1
|
Send fee info with init data
|
2022-06-01 00:03:25 +04:00 |
|
wiz
|
de8a51fe9a
|
Merge branch 'master' into nymkappa/bugfix/bisq-dump-file
|
2022-06-01 03:47:12 +09:00 |
|
nymkappa
|
c7e9b47aa0
|
Only attempt to save fx rate if database is enabled
|
2022-05-31 20:29:43 +02:00 |
|
wiz
|
4c90d8e811
|
Merge branch 'master' into nymkappa/bugfix/bisq-dump-file
|
2022-06-01 03:10:50 +09:00 |
|
wiz
|
39f33dded2
|
Merge branch 'master' into nymkappa/feature/remove-fee-calculation-frontend
|
2022-06-01 02:44:48 +09:00 |
|
wiz
|
4ccd786fe9
|
Change backend start syslog message from DEBUG to NOTICE
|
2022-06-01 01:09:08 +09:00 |
|
wiz
|
72c3eea863
|
Merge branch 'master' into nymkappa/bugfix/bisq-dump-file
|
2022-06-01 00:14:43 +09:00 |
|
wiz
|
ce49dca7c8
|
Merge branch 'master' into nymkappa/feature/historical-rates
|
2022-05-31 23:58:51 +09:00 |
|
wiz
|
44215a2108
|
Merge branch 'master' into simon/update-packages
|
2022-05-31 18:54:34 +09:00 |
|
wiz
|
6b2b10960a
|
Merge branch 'master' into nymkappa/feature/remove-fee-calculation-frontend
|
2022-05-31 18:34:49 +09:00 |
|
wiz
|
1cb772da39
|
Merge branch 'master' into nymkappa/feature/additional-fee-tiers
|
2022-05-31 18:28:33 +09:00 |
|
wiz
|
260fd030b5
|
Merge branch 'master' into nymkappa/bugfix/block-url-link
|
2022-05-31 18:20:47 +09:00 |
|
nymkappa
|
c246ed958f
|
Create rates table on all networks
|
2022-05-31 11:20:31 +02:00 |
|
nymkappa
|
f20cf266b6
|
Remove frontend fee calculation and read it from the websocket instead
|
2022-05-31 10:41:43 +02:00 |
|
nymkappa
|
09b2e21fea
|
Add economyFee field in /api/fees/recommended API
|
2022-05-31 10:40:58 +02:00 |
|
wiz
|
0ecc03e484
|
Merge branch 'master' into nymkappa/feature/historical-rates
|
2022-05-31 17:35:54 +09:00 |
|
wiz
|
288a96ed43
|
Merge branch 'master' into nymkappa/bugfix/pool-parser-db-check
|
2022-05-31 17:09:41 +09:00 |
|
softsimon
|
3935aef841
|
Upgrading packages
|
2022-05-31 02:21:05 +04:00 |
|
nymkappa
|
99902e70c7
|
Use block hash instead of block height in urls
|
2022-05-27 20:43:14 +02:00 |
|
nymkappa
|
be3d8b5ed9
|
Mining dashboard still runs fine if Bitcoin Core becomes unavailable
|
2022-05-27 11:26:56 +02:00 |
|
wiz
|
1ba0077666
|
Merge pull request #1714 from hunicus/install-manual
Move manual install notes to separate docs
|
2022-05-27 18:22:13 +09:00 |
|
nymkappa
|
e590759b7b
|
Don't try to run pools parser if db is not enabled
|
2022-05-27 10:31:49 +02:00 |
|
hunicus
|
b7c918b79d
|
Mention "esplora" value for blockstream/electrs
|
2022-05-26 22:13:37 -04:00 |
|
hunicus
|
28439bff7d
|
Add recommended versions for node and npm
|
2022-05-26 18:19:58 -04:00 |
|
hunicus
|
c69d0e8148
|
Add note on mysql install brought up in #1731
|
2022-05-26 17:57:48 -04:00 |
|
hunicus
|
3e82e432c6
|
Add manual backend setup notes to backend/ readme
|
2022-05-26 17:42:15 -04:00 |
|
wiz
|
df9c9e334d
|
Merge branch 'master' into nymkappa/feature/use-block-count-timespan
|
2022-05-25 20:16:32 +09:00 |
|
nymkappa
|
c402422682
|
Remove last trace of legacy oldestIndexedBlockTimestamp
|
2022-05-25 12:10:09 +02:00 |
|
wiz
|
aac9dda9ef
|
Merge branch 'master' into nymkappa/feature/merge-blocks
|
2022-05-25 18:55:13 +09:00 |
|
wiz
|
e059b9d379
|
Merge pull request #1685 from mempool/nymkappa/feature/update-api-case
Update case in some mining API endpoint response
|
2022-05-25 18:54:47 +09:00 |
|
nymkappa
|
875040c329
|
Save bisq aggregate exchange rates in the database for each new block
|
2022-05-25 10:51:35 +02:00 |
|
nymkappa
|
9e0fdec053
|
Merge branch 'master' into nymkappa/feature/merge-blocks
|
2022-05-24 10:14:06 +02:00 |
|
Felipe Knorr Kuhn
|
9fbd014df9
|
Merge branch 'master' into nymkappa/bugfix/reindex-when-fast-forward
|
2022-05-23 21:08:54 -07:00 |
|
nymkappa
|
88fba3f506
|
For non Bitcoin network, run legacy API code, but keep the same endpoint
|
2022-05-23 13:02:18 +02:00 |
|
nymkappa
|
37b7ea6702
|
Merge legacy and mining /blocks components and APIs
|
2022-05-23 09:08:40 +02:00 |
|
wiz
|
f42da0e3ac
|
Merge branch 'master' into nymkappa/feature/update-api-case
|
2022-05-21 03:18:57 +09:00 |
|
wiz
|
6cd3c312dd
|
Merge branch 'master' into nymkappa/bugfix/update-log
|
2022-05-21 03:03:56 +09:00 |
|
softsimon
|
521418bd25
|
Progressbar calculation fix
|
2022-05-20 21:50:01 +04:00 |
|
softsimon
|
e092fa6286
|
Adding fee reveal text
|
2022-05-20 21:30:01 +04:00 |
|
softsimon
|
fb63817282
|
Lazy load tx inputs in Bitcoin Core mode
fixes #465
|
2022-05-20 21:30:01 +04:00 |
|
wiz
|
159b6ad04b
|
Merge branch 'master' into nymkappa/feature/update-api-case
|
2022-05-20 21:03:41 +09:00 |
|
wiz
|
55f2cf06af
|
Merge pull request #1688 from mempool/simon/mempool-tx-fee-bug
Fixes broken fee rate calculation for mempool transactions
|
2022-05-20 21:03:34 +09:00 |
|
softsimon
|
5028df31ba
|
Fixes broken fee rate calculation for mempool transactions
fixes #1684
|
2022-05-20 13:41:30 +04:00 |
|
nymkappa
|
018914a4b6
|
Set /mining/blocks/xxx APIs expiration to 60 seconds instead of 5 minutes
|
2022-05-20 09:53:24 +02:00 |
|
nymkappa
|
e101c4e218
|
Replace all avg_XXX with avgXXX for consistency
|
2022-05-20 09:44:29 +02:00 |
|
Felipe Knorr Kuhn
|
449d6b17aa
|
Merge branch 'master' into nymkappa/bugfix/reindex-when-fast-forward
|
2022-05-19 10:01:06 -07:00 |
|
nymkappa
|
a58d5b84b6
|
Set expiration to 1 min for /mining/reward-stats/:blockCount and /blocks-extras/:height
|
2022-05-19 17:20:42 +02:00 |
|
nymkappa
|
2a8314efc5
|
Move indexing logic into Indexer class
|
2022-05-19 16:41:14 +02:00 |
|
nymkappa
|
7f8696c88d
|
Make sure to re-index skipped block when backend is offline for too long
|
2022-05-19 16:41:13 +02:00 |
|
wiz
|
b2775509e2
|
Merge branch 'master' into nymkappa/feature/block-api-cache
|
2022-05-19 19:31:32 +09:00 |
|
nymkappa
|
75dcfdd851
|
Cache /block API response for 10 min on user side
|
2022-05-19 12:17:26 +02:00 |
|
nymkappa
|
04bc41df3b
|
Index blocks.hash
|
2022-05-19 12:13:43 +02:00 |
|
nymkappa
|
f402bfb097
|
Remove unescessary log
|
2022-05-18 15:01:24 +02:00 |
|
wiz
|
b22cae8da1
|
Merge pull request #1649 from ayanamitech/fix-poolupdater
pools-updater: Support secure Tor connection to sync data with Github
|
2022-05-18 21:11:32 +09:00 |
|
wiz
|
f91d9239e6
|
Merge branch 'master' into simon/getrawtransaction-recursive-fix
|
2022-05-18 20:11:20 +09:00 |
|
softsimon
|
2dad8ba8ec
|
Fix for transactions being fetched recursively
|
2022-05-18 15:06:44 +04:00 |
|
wiz
|
dddf83a2d3
|
Merge branch 'master' into nymkappa/feature/10min-blocktime-after-adjustment
|
2022-05-18 20:02:29 +09:00 |
|
wiz
|
3fd2d74f81
|
Merge branch 'master' into nymkappa/feature/cleanup-mining-api-endpoints
|
2022-05-18 19:51:38 +09:00 |
|
Ayanami
|
0b351b9fcb
|
pools-updater: Support secure Tor connection to sync data with Github
Use Axios instead of native https
|
2022-05-18 11:20:28 +09:00 |
|
nymkappa
|
5da94fa793
|
Delete useless log
|
2022-05-17 15:58:11 +02:00 |
|
nymkappa
|
47bb073b9a
|
Define avg block time to 10 min until we have at least 146 block in the current epoch
|
2022-05-17 14:40:18 +02:00 |
|
nymkappa
|
df59c21cfe
|
Cleanup mining API endpoints
|
2022-05-17 12:02:50 +02:00 |
|
wiz
|
094257a9df
|
Merge branch 'master' into nymkappa/feature/update-block-api
|
2022-05-17 15:57:05 +09:00 |
|
nymkappa
|
7e8e4b1e6c
|
If bisq data folder is not ready, retry every 3 minutes instead of exit
|
2022-05-13 11:54:52 +02:00 |
|
nymkappa
|
9377faea9c
|
Skip missing blocks during block hash chain validation
|
2022-05-13 10:34:32 +02:00 |
|
nymkappa
|
d26b1436b5
|
Always expose /block/{hash} API in the node backend
|
2022-05-12 08:13:42 +02:00 |
|
nymkappa
|
384c8d17cf
|
Only process mining pools on Bitcoin networks
|
2022-05-12 08:13:41 +02:00 |
|
nymkappa
|
ff74e6ea8c
|
If block exists in memory cache, return it directly for /block API
|
2022-05-12 08:13:41 +02:00 |
|
nymkappa
|
057b5bd2e1
|
Update block API to use indexing if available
|
2022-05-12 08:13:40 +02:00 |
|
Felipe Knorr Kuhn
|
5ca9de5a42
|
Fix the socks5 connection after updating the socks lib
|
2022-05-11 19:08:41 -07:00 |
|
nymkappa
|
e9620b7b48
|
Add block sizes and weights graph
|
2022-05-10 16:41:40 +02:00 |
|
nymkappa
|
3e90650536
|
Add /api/v1/mining/blocks/sizes-weights/:interval API
|
2022-05-10 16:41:23 +02:00 |
|
nymkappa
|
de7c4774ec
|
Added indexing progress indicator for hashrates, update logging
|
2022-05-10 15:48:21 +02:00 |
|